Restoration & Repair to Legation de France, Austin, Texas. For The Daughters of the Republic of Texas

Description: These are the blueprints of the restoration of the Legation de France, now the French Legation Museum maintained by the Daughters of the Republic of Texas. The architectural renderings were drawn in white on three sheets, each of which is labeled in part of the title box at the bottom of every page (in the lower right corner). Magnolia Mobilgas Service Station

Description: Photograph of the exterior of a new Magnolia Mobilgas service station at 2901 Cherrywood Rd. during its grand opening on April 30, 1955. Helmer Johnson was the owner. Attendants are servicing a Studebaker and a Mercury.
